Achieving Success
Dec. 24, 2024
The key to achieving success | The Guardian Nigeria News - Nigeria and World News — Features — The Guardian Nigeria News – Nigeria and World News Achieve Success Faster With These 10 Tips | Inc.com Achieving Success | Birmingham Achieving Success